Computer-Aided Analysis of Protection and Automation Systems

Major: Electrical Energetics, Electrical Engineering and Electromechanics
Code of Subject: 7.141.06.E.163
Credits: 5
Department: Electric Power Engineering and Control Systems
Lecturer: Doctor of Technical Sciences., Associate Professor Ravlyk Oleksander
Semester: 2 семестр
Mode of Study: денна
Learning outcomes:
• knowledge of the requirements for a modern information-controling systems of protection and automation, operation principles, characteristics and features of the main primary converters of information and executive tools;
• knowledge of the basic algorithms for operation systems of protection and automation;
• ability to apply modern methods of analysis and synthesis of information-controling systems of protection and automatics, analyze known algorithms and develop new operation, calculate their basic parameters to analyze their behavior in normal and emergency operation of electric power facilities.
Required prior and related subjects:
• Computer-Aided Design of Devices for Relay Protection and Automation;
• Information Technologies for Electricity Production and Distribution Management.
Summary of the subject:
Modern specialized digital systems for the computer analysis and synthesis of information-control systems of protection and automation. Simulation as one of the main means of analysis and synthesis. Basic requirements for the design and analysis of information-control systems of protection and automation. Methods of forming and solving the state equations describing the behavior of systems of protection and automation, mathematical models and basic elements forming the basis for settlement schemes and algorithms for operation in a specialized software. Analysis of existing and development of new information-control systems of protection and automation.
